Incazelo emfushane:

I-AMB Series Unmanned Chassis AMB (Auto Mobile Base) yemoto ezimele ye-agv, i-chassis ebanzi eyenzelwe izimoto eziqondiswa yi-agv ezizimele, inikeza ezinye izici ezifana nokuhlela imephu kanye nokuzulazula kwendawo. Le chassis engenamuntu yenqola ye-agv inikeza izixhumi eziningi ezifana ne-I/O kanye ne-CAN ukufaka amamojula ahlukahlukene aphezulu kanye nesofthiwe yamakhasimende enamandla kanye nezinhlelo zokuthumela ukusiza abasebenzisi ukuthi baqedele ngokushesha ukukhiqiza nokusebenzisa izimoto ezizimele ze-agv. Kunezimbobo ezine zokufaka phezulu kwe-chassis engenamuntu yochungechunge lwe-AMB yezimoto eziqondiswa yi-agv ezizimele, esekela ukwanda okungahleliwe nge-jacking, ama-rollers, ama-manipulators, i-latent traction, isibonisi, njll. ukufeza izinhlelo eziningi ze-chassis eyodwa. I-AMB kanye ne-SEER Enterprise Enhanced Digitalization ingafeza ukuthunyelwa okuhlangene kanye nokuthunyelwa kwemikhiqizo eminingi ye-AMB ngesikhathi esisodwa, okuthuthukisa kakhulu izinga lobuhlakani bezinto zangaphakathi kanye nezokuthutha efektri.

Isici

I-AGV AMR

 

·Umthamo womthwalo: 150kg kanye no-300kg

·Ukuphakama okuphezulu kwe-jacking: 50mm

·Ukunemba kwesikhundla sokuzulazula: ± 5mm

·ukunemba kwe-angle yokuzulazula: ± 0.5°

 

● Izici ezicebile ziyatholakala nganoma yisiphi isikhathi

Izici ezijwayelekile eziphelele nezinhle kakhulu kanye nezici ezithuthukisiwe ezicebile nezisebenzayo zisiza amakhasimende ukuthi afinyelele kalula izinto ezihlakaniphile.

● Amapulatifomu anemininingwane eminingi atholakalayo ukuze anwetshwe

Nikeza amapulatifomu angu-150kg kanye no-300kg ukuze kuhlangatshezwane nezidingo zomthwalo kanye nezendawo zezimboni ezahlukene. Ingasetshenziswa futhi nama-manipulators, ama-roller, ama-jacking, i-latent traction, i-pan/tilt, isikrini sokubonisa, njll. ukuze kufezwe izinhlelo zokusebenza eziningi nge-chassis eyodwa.

● ±5 mm, isebenza kahle futhi inembile

I-algorithm ye-Laser SLAM isetshenziselwa ukufeza indawo enembile kakhulu, ngokunemba okuphindaphindiwe kokuthola indawo okungabonisi i-laser ngaphakathi kuka-±5 mm, okuvumela ukudokha okungenamthungo phakathi kwamarobhothi ahambayo nabantu, kanye nokugeleza kwemithwalo okuphumelelayo phakathi kwamaphuzu ahlukahlukene. Qaphela: Amanani angempela ancike ezimweni zemvelo.

● Ukuzulazula okuzinzile kokuphepha nokuthembeka

Ukuzulazula kwe-Laser SLAM, ukuzulazula kwe-laser reflector, ukuzulazula kwekhodi ye-QR kanye nezinye izindlela zokuzulazula kuhlanganiswe kahle futhi kushintshwa kalula ukuqinisekisa ukusebenza okuzinzile kwerobhothi elihambayo.

● Ukufakwa okulula nokuphathwa okubonakalayo

Uhla oluphelele lwesofthiwe esekelayo kanye nezinhlelo zedijithali lungafeza kalula ukusebenza, ukuhlela kanye nokuphathwa kolwazi lwamarobhothi eselula, futhi luxhumane kalula nohlelo lwe-MES lwefektri ukuze kufezwe ngempela izinto ezihlakaniphile.
